+/**
+ * The sca reference binding provider mediates between the twin requirements of
+ * local sca bindings and remote sca bindings. In the local case is does
+ * very little. When the sca binding model is set as being remote (because a
+ * reference target can't be resolved in the current model) this binding will
+ * try and create a remote connection to it
+ *
+ * @version $Rev$ $Date$
+ */
+public class RuntimeSCAReferenceBindingProvider implements ReferenceBindingProvider {
+
+ private static final Logger logger = Logger.getLogger(RuntimeSCAReferenceBindingProvider.class.getName());
+
+ private RuntimeComponent component;
+ private RuntimeComponentReference reference;
+ private SCABinding binding;
+ private boolean started = false;
+
+ private BindingProviderFactory<DistributedSCABinding> distributedProviderFactory = null;
+ private ReferenceBindingProvider distributedProvider = null;
+
+ public RuntimeSCAReferenceBindingProvider(ExtensionPointRegistry extensionPoints,
+ RuntimeComponent component,
+ RuntimeComponentReference reference,
+ SCABinding binding) {
+ this.component = component;
+ this.reference = reference;
+ this.binding = binding;
+
+ // look to see if a distributed SCA binding implementation has
+ // been included on the classpath. This will be needed by the
+ // provider itself to do it's thing
+ ProviderFactoryExtensionPoint factoryExtensionPoint =
+ extensionPoints.getExtensionPoint(ProviderFactoryExtensionPoint.class);
+ distributedProviderFactory =
+ (BindingProviderFactory<DistributedSCABinding>)factoryExtensionPoint
+ .getProviderFactory(DistributedSCABinding.class);
+
+ }
+
+ public boolean isTargetRemote() {
+ boolean targetIsRemote = false;
+
+ // first look at the target service and see if this has been resolved
+ OptimizableBinding optimizableBinding = (OptimizableBinding)binding;
+
+ // The decision is based on the results of the wiring process in the assembly model
+ // The SCA binding is used to represent unresolved reference targets, i.e. those
+ // reference targets that need resolving at run time. We can tell by lookin if the
+ // service to which this binding refers is resolved or not.
+ //
+ // TODO - When a callback is in operation. A callback reference bindings sometimes has to
+ // act as though there is a local wire and sometimes as if there is a remote wire
+ // what are the implications of this here?
+
+ if (RemoteBindingHelper.isTargetRemote()) {
+ if (reference.getInterfaceContract() != null) {
+ targetIsRemote = reference.getInterfaceContract().getInterface().isRemotable();
+ } else {
+ targetIsRemote = true;
+ }
+ } else if (optimizableBinding.getTargetComponentService() != null) {
+ if (optimizableBinding.getTargetComponentService().isUnresolved() == true) {
+ targetIsRemote = true;
+ } else {
+ targetIsRemote = false;
+ }
+ } else {
+ // the case where the wire is specified by URI, e.g. callbacks or user specified bindings, and
+ // look at the provided URI to decide whether it is a local or remote case
+ try {
+ URI uri = new URI(binding.getURI());
+ if (uri.isAbsolute()) {
+ targetIsRemote = true;
+ } else {
+ targetIsRemote = false;
+ }
+ } catch (Exception ex) {
+ targetIsRemote = false;
+ }
+ }
+ return targetIsRemote;
+ }
